<description>It was a choice to melt down Robert E. Lee. But it would have been a choice to keep him intact, too. So the statue of the Confederate general that once stood in Charlottesville &#x26;#x2014; the one that prompted the deadly &#x26;#x201C;Unite the Right&#x26;#x201D; rally in 2017 &#x26;#x2014; was now being cut into fragments and dropped into a furnace, dissolving into a sludge of glowing bronze. Six years ago, groups with ties to the Confederacy had sued to stop the monument from being taken down.
